PIGS IN A BLANKET STADIUM RECIPE BY TASTY
Here's what you need: puff pastry, eggs, hot dogs, spinach artichoke dip, chili dip, queso dip
Provided by Alvin Zhou
Categories Appetizers
Yield 15 servings
Number Of Ingredients 6
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 350°F (180°C).
- Roll out the puff pastry into a square shape and brush the surface with egg wash.
- Cut the puff pastry sheet into 6 equal rectangles.
- Place a hot dog on the bottom of each pastry rectangle, then roll it up tightly.
- Slice each rolled hot dog into 3 equal segments.
- Repeat with the remaining puff pastry and hot dogs.
- In a large springform pan, place a circular wall of the hot dog pieces around the circumference of the edge. Stack a second row of rolled hot dogs on top, so that they go up the entire side of the pan.
- Build a 3-way wall with more hot dogs that all meet in the center to create 3 holes for the dips.
- Carefully place each dip into each open space, spreading them out evenly and making sure the walls don't move.
- Cover with foil and bake for 1 hour and 45 minutes.
- Remove the foil and bake uncovered for another 30 minutes until the pastry is crispy.
- Cool until warm to the touch. Unclasp the springform pan.
- Enjoy!

PIGS-IN-A-BLANKET WITH SAUERKRAUT AND MUSTARD
Classic German flavors bring a fresh twist to this beloved hors d'oeuvre. We love the combination of buttery puff pastry with tangy sauerkraut and the subtle heat of mustard.
Provided by Rhoda Boone
Categories Appetizer Sausage Phyllo/Puff Pastry Dough Mustard snack Hors D'Oeuvre
Yield Makes 32 pieces
Number Of Ingredients 6
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 400°F. Set racks in the upper and lower thirds of the oven. Line two 13x18-inch baking sheets with parchment paper. In a small bowl, beat the egg with 1 tablespoon water. Prep the ingredients for the filling and set aside.
- If using a 17-ounce puff pastry package, roll each sheet to a 9x12-inch rectangle. Cut each piece lengthwise into eight 1 1/2-inch wide strips. Cut each strip crosswise into two pieces, about 4 1/2 inches long. You should have 32 pieces of pastry.
- Spread the center of each piece of pastry with 1/2 teaspoon mustard and top with 1/2 teaspoon sauerkraut. Brush one narrow end of the pastry with egg wash, add one piece of sausage, and roll to enclose. Return to parchment-lined baking sheets. Brush the top of each pastry with egg wash and sprinkle with caraway seeds, seam-side down. Chill in refrigerator for 15 minutes. Bake until golden brown and puffed, 23 to 27 minutes.
PIGS IN A BLANKET
This tasty recipe for pigs in a blanket is a Super Bowl party favorite -- and great everyday snack.
Provided by Martha Stewart
Categories Food & Cooking Appetizers
Yield Makes about 4 1/2 dozen
Number Of Ingredients 9
Steps:
- Cut hot dogs lengthwise 3/4 of the way through. Insert a piece of cheese or 1/2 teaspoon caramelized onions into each hot dog, if using; set aside. If not using cheese or onions, poke hot dogs several times with the tip of a knife.
- On a lightly floured work surface, working with one sheet of puff pastry at a time, roll into a 14-by-11-inch rectangle. Cut lengthwise into seven 1 1/2-inch wide strips. Cut each strip crosswise into 4 rectangles, each about 3 1/2 inches long.
- In a small bowl, beat together egg and 1 tablespoon water; set aside. Line baking sheets with parchment paper or a nonstick baking mat; set aside. Place a hot dog on the narrow end of one piece of pastry. Roll to enclose, brushing with some of the beaten egg to adhere; transfer to prepared baking sheet. Repeat process with remaining hot dogs and pastry. Brush the tops of puff pastry with egg and sprinkle with seeds, if using. Transfer to refrigerator and let chill for 15 minutes.
- Preheat oven to 450 degrees.
- Transfer baking sheets to oven and bake until puffed and golden, about 20 minutes. Let cool briefly before serving with mustard and ketchup.

PIGS IN BLANKETS (GERMAN CABBAGE ROLLS)
We always made these at harvest time when the neighbors got together and filled silo. This is how I learned to make them from my grandmother.
Provided by sklhczech
Categories Low Cholesterol
Time 2h
Yield 16 rolls, 8 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 7
Steps:
- Brown ground beef and onion. Salt and pepper to taste. Drain grease. Stir together rice and browned ground beef and set aside.
- Bring a large kettle of water to a boil and remove from heat.
- Carefully remove 16 leaves from the head of cabbage and put leaves in the water and let set until wilted.
- Remove a leaf from the water with tongs, take a good sized tablespoon of the hamburger-rice mixture into the leaf and wrap leaf around the burger mixture. May need to secure with a toothpick to keep closed.
- Place in a greased 9x13 pan.
- Repeat with remaining leaves and burger mixture.
- When you have used all the mixture, pour tomato juice and water over top of cabbage rolls.
- Cover and bake for an hour at 325.
